>>> My RealURL conf reads:
>>>
>>> array(
>>> 'GETvar' => 'L',
>>> 'valueMap' => array(
>>> 'de' => '1',
>>> 'fr' => '2',
>>> 'it' => '3',
>>> 'en' => '4',
>>> ),
>>> 'valueDefault' => 'fr',
>>> ),
>> Indeed (and that's the way it should work btw), the mapping of 'fr' is
>> taken when generating links, leading to use '2' instead of default '0'.
>> This means that I should dynamically remove the fr mapping when French
>> is my default language.
>
> Hmm, what did you expect? :) You told realurl to set L=2 when there /fr/ segment. Realurl did what you asked. All correct.
